Hi Ghochi,
First if you want user not to directly log in to Portal then disable the automatic logon setting frominternet explorer.
Tools > Internet Options > Advance > Enable internet Authentication (uncheck checkbox) restart browser. Next time user will not directly login to Portal. But user needs to enter user ID/PWD every time.
Coming to your problem for http sessions,
1. On click of log off button, sessions are not getting released. Please check what is the value once user clicks on log off button. This you can check in Visual admin.
2. Also, go to SM04 in ECC and check how many http sessions you are having.

    we are facing some problem regarding our EP 7.0 SP13. We have an anonymous page as our home page, with some anonymous ivews, like "help", "news", etc and one iview with authentication set to default where users log into the portal and access to the private section of the portal.
    That ivew does a redirection to /irj/portal and since the user is athenticated it will led him to the private home. The problem is that after logon, a Java iview runtime error appears, and users must refresh the browser to access the private section. (user is logged before the error appears).
    We have checked this is not happening with users with "super admin" o "content admin" role. They are able to log into the portal, and redirection is working fine. So we think there can be some problem with security zones or authentication somewhere in the portal, but since this is the standard logon component i don´t know why is this not working.
    We have checked that the redirection is working, and we have made some tests with different kind of iviews like KM iviews, URL iviews, pictures, etc. Only admin users are able to log in correctly, the others get the java iview runtime error, so we think the problem is with to standard logon...

    The problem was solved, it was a permission problem.
    The anonymous role which allow access to the anonymous section of the portal was assigned to anonymous user, but it hasn´t everyone permission. So anonymous users were able to see anonymous pages, but when they login they lose the role, and java iview error happened, unless they had admin rights.
    Solved assigned by assigning everyone to that role.
